Cypress High School Accident Sparks Calls for Improved Student Safety Measures

In a troubling incident at Cypress Park High School, a student was struck and pinned by a car in the school's parking lot, leading to a mother's impassioned plea for the district to prioritize student safety. The accident has raised concerns about the school's emergency response protocols and the need for comprehensive safety measures to protect students on campus.

A Cypress Mom's Heartbreaking Ordeal: Natisha Walton's Daughter Struck in School Parking LotNatisha Walton's daughter, Morgan Johnson, was walking to a friend's car in the Cy-Park High School student parking lot when she was hit and pinned by a student driver. Walton, distressed, rushed to the scene, only to find her daughter sitting on the road, "screaming and crying with no help."Delayed Emergency Response and Lack of AssistanceWalton claims that when she arrived, the on-campus officers were reportedly handling a school-wide pep rally, and there was no principal, police, or other staff members present to assist her daughter. She expressed her frustration, saying, "I should not have beat the officer there. If it was their child, I think they would understand a little bit better."The Long Road to RecoveryMorgan Johnson will need to make another hospital visit before beginning physical therapy, and Walton says her daughter's recovery will be a lengthy process. Walton feels strongly that more could have been done to assist her daughter in the critical moments following the accident.Cy-Fair ISD's Response and AccountabilityIn a statement, Cy-Fair Independent School District acknowledged that officers were on campus during the accident, but they were handling a school-wide pep-rally. The district maintains that the officers responded promptly once they were made aware of the incident, beginning an immediate investigation.Walton, however, disagrees with the district's explanation, arguing that the response time was unacceptable and that the school's priorities should have been focused on student safety rather than a pep-rally.Calling for Comprehensive Safety MeasuresAs Walton continues to support her daughter's recovery, she hopes her story will encourage the school district to reassess how they handle incidents involving student safety.
